This is a light hearted read about a young boy who has a rare eye cancer and needs to deal with everyday life including school.

Ross Molloy tries to get along in the best way he can despite having to deal with his cancer because he has Batpig, an
unusual superhero of his own imagination.

The author has used humour combined with a superhero comic strip to narrate his own personal account of dealing with eye cancer. The illustrations are black and white. However, the front cover is bright, colourful and bold.

I did like the first part of the story and would've loved to read what happens next. Both cancer and death are issues that affect us and different people deal with it in different ways.
